The Phobians legend insists that Ghana Football Association should welcome the news that Avram Grant is being chased by Swansea City

Former Hearts of Oak coach Mohammed Polo believes Ghana Football Association should accept reports linking Black Stars coach Avram Grant to English Premier League side Swansea City.

The 60-year-old has been linked to the vacant seat alongside Gus Poyet and Brendan Rogers after the dismissal of Gary Monk.

“Grant can go! Didn’t Kwesi Appiah take us to the World Cup as a local coach?” Polo told Happy FM.

“Why do GFA keep these kinds of coaches for? We should let him go and develop our own. He has brought us nothing new to the team.

“His performance is the same and even enjoying what Kwesi Appiah started,” he added.

However, Grant’s agent Saif Rabie has rubbished links to his client insisting that no formal contact has been made by Swansea.

“On the record, just to say as Avram Grant’s agent that he is happy as the coach of @ghanafaofficial Blackstars. @SwansOfficial not in touch,” Rubie posted on Twitter.

Grant has one year left on his contract which ends in 2017.
